
Kyiv says Ukrainian journalist died in Russian captivity
Ukraine says Victoria Roshchyna died in Russian detention.
Officials in Kyiv say a Ukrainian journalist who was being held in Russian detention has died. Victoria Roshchyna went missing last year while reporting from a Russian-occupied part of eastern Ukraine.
